Ancient Greek-English Dictionary Language

ἀνεξάλειπτος

First/Second declension Adjective; Transliteration:

Principal Part: ἀνεξάλειπτος ἀνεξάλειπτη ἀνεξάλειπτον

Structure: ἀνεξαλειπτ (Stem) + ος (Ending)

Etym.: e)calei/fw

Sense

  1. indelible

Examples

  • τὸ μὲν γὰρ ἀλλοῖον τῶν ὀφθαλμῶν ἐστιν ἐπίκαιροσ γοητεία, τὸ δὲ σύμφυτοσ καὶ ἀνεξάλειπτοσ καὶ ἀίδιοσ οἰκίασ κόσμοσ. (Epictetus, Works, gnomologium epicteteum e( stobaei libris 3-4) 40:2)
